Project results evaluation
CALPHAD phase diagram calculations of Cr Ta, -Ti,-Zr systems were done using ab initio energies of formation of C14, C15 and C36 Laves phases. Magnetism of both C15 Laves phase of pure Cr and sigma phases in Cr-Fe and Cr-Co systems was analysed.
